The Georgia EdTech and Smart Classrooms Market was estimated at USD 1081 Million in 2025 and is projected to reach USD 1802 Million by 2032, growing at a CAGR of 11.1% from 2026 to 2032.
Recent momentum in the Georgia EdTech and Smart Classrooms market highlights a surge in technology adoption across educational institutions. As schools increasingly embrace digital learning tools, the focus is shifting towards integrating advanced solutions that enhance educational outcomes.
Looking ahead, the market is set for expansive growth as educators and administrators recognize the importance of engaging and interactive learning environments. The ongoing investments in infrastructure and technology position Georgia as a competitive hub for EdTech innovation.

Despite the impressive growth trajectory, the Georgia EdTech and Smart Classrooms market faces real constraints. Many schools still grapple with outdated infrastructure, limiting their ability to implement advanced digital solutions. Additionally, access to high-speed internet remains a significant hurdle in rural regions, creating a digital divide among students. Varying levels of tech literacy among educators further complicate the adoption of innovative teaching methods. Addressing these issues requires targeted investments and strategic planning.
Key trends shaping the Georgia EdTech and Smart Classrooms market include the integration of artificial intelligence and virtual reality in educational tools. These technologies are being utilized to create immersive learning experiences that cater to diverse learning styles. The rise of personalized learning platforms is also notable, as they enable educators to tailor their teaching strategies to individual student needs. on top of that, the ongoing emphasis on remote and hybrid learning continues to drive demand for comprehensive digital solutions.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
